Critical Chrome Use After Free Vulnerability Enables Arbitrary Code Execution

5g (5)

Google has released an urgent security update for Chrome to fix a critical use-after-free (UAF) vulnerability (CVE-2025-9478) found in the ANGLE graphics library. This flaw could allow attackers to execute arbitrary code and potentially take over affected systems.

The issue impacts Chrome versions earlier than 139.0.7258.154/.155 across Windows, macOS, and Linux.

Discovery and Severity

The vulnerability was discovered on August 11, 2025, by Google’s Big Sleep AI-powered vulnerability research team. It has been rated with the highest CVSS score of 9.8 (Critical), highlighting the severe risk of exploitation.

What is ANGLE and Why It Matters

ANGLE (Almost Native Graphics Layer Engine) translates OpenGL ES API calls into platform-specific graphics APIs such as Direct3D, Vulkan, and OpenGL. Since ANGLE is widely used for WebGL rendering, HTML5 Canvas, and GPU-accelerated graphics, a flaw in its memory handling exposes millions of users to risk.

Exploitation Method

Use-after-free vulnerabilities arise when software continues to use memory after it has been released. In this case, specially crafted web content could exploit improper memory deallocation routines in ANGLE, leading to arbitrary code execution with the privileges of Chrome’s renderer process.

A successful attack could escalate further, enabling sandbox escapes and full system compromise. Threat actors could weaponize this vulnerability through:

  • Malicious websites
  • Drive-by downloads
  • Malvertising campaigns

Risk Summary

Risk FactorsDetails
Affected ProductsChrome Desktop ≤ 139.0.7258.153 (Windows, macOS, Linux)
ImpactArbitrary code execution
Exploit PrerequisitesUser visits malicious GPU-accelerated web content
CVSS 3.1 Score9.8 (Critical)

Mitigation and Recommendations

  • Update immediately to Chrome 139.0.7258.154 or later.
  • Apply application allowlisting, network segmentation, and EDR monitoring.
  • Use Content Security Policy (CSP) headers and browser isolation to reduce attack vectors.
  • Monitor for suspicious indicators like unusual traffic patterns, abnormal memory use, or unexpected process spawning.

With the possibility of zero-day exploitation, organizations and end users should act quickly to patch systems and tighten defenses.
